Education Paths

The first step in differentiating between an engineer and an engineering technician lies in their respective educational backgrounds. Engineers typically hold a bachelor's degree in a specific engineering discipline, such as civil, mechanical, electrical, or software engineering. This education involves a deep understanding of scientific and mathematical principles, along with hands-on experience through internships and projects. In contrast, engineering technicians often pursue associate degrees or diplomas in engineering technology or related fields. These programs focus on practical applications of engineering principles, with a strong emphasis on skills like troubleshooting, testing, and maintenance.

Benefits of a Bachelor's Degree for Engineers:

Comprehensive theoretical knowledge in design and innovation Preparation for advanced studies, like master's degrees or licensure Eligibility for more diverse and high-level positions Stronger foundation for research and development

Benefits of an Associate Degree for Engineering Technicians:

Focused on practical skills and hands-on experience Direct preparation for industry roles requiring applied knowledge Quicker entry into the workforce compared to bachelor's degree holders Cost-effective and time-efficient for those prioritizing immediate entry into the field

Responsibilities and Scope

The core responsibilities of engineers and engineering technicians differ based on their education and training. Engineers are responsible for the overall design, development, and management of engineering projects. This includes research, analysis, project management, and adherence to safety and performance standards. Engineering technicians play a crucial role in supporting engineers by implementing designs, conducting tests, and troubleshooting equipment and systems. They are also responsible for maintaining technical documentation and creating reports based on experimental results.

Engineer Responsibilities:

Designing and developing engineering projects Conducting research and analysis to solve complex problems Managing projects, including budgeting, scheduling, and team supervision Ensuring designs meet safety and performance standards Pursuing professional licensure

Engineering Technician/Technical Engineer Responsibilities:

Supporting engineers by implementing designs and conducting tests Working on practical applications of engineering principles Troubleshooting, maintaining, and repairing equipment and systems Assisting in drafting technical documentation and creating reports

Note that in some industries, engineering technicians may have more autonomy and independence, especially in manufacturing settings. However, their primary focus remains on the implementation and practical application of designs.

Job Structure and Career Ladders

Both roles often have a hierarchical structure within engineering departments. Engineers typically have higher authority and responsibility levels compared to engineering technicians. In many companies, technicians are under the supervision of engineers and may be assigned specific tasks or projects. These technicians often build prototypes and assist in the debugging process. In larger organizations, project engineers oversee new product development, ensuring the projects are successful and serving as a technical point of contact with customers.

Engineering technicians can be categorized into different groups based on their roles. In electronics-related industries, for example, their responsibilities might include designing injection molds and creating fixturing. They are also the primary troubleshooters in production settings, addressing and resolving issues on the manufacturing floor.
